    I have had problems with my knees in the past too.  Here is what works wonders for me:  Take 2 advil after walking or exercising, follow the exercise with 20 minutes of ice, take a super hot shower or use a heating pad an hour or so after icing.   After a day or two I can drop the advil and just ice and heat.
